The Growing Demand for ISO Tank Containers
The ISO tank container market is experiencing robust growth, projected to reach USD 5.03 billion by 2028. This surge is attributed to the rising demand for safe and efficient transportation of liquids and bulk materials. As industries expand, especially in Southeast Asia and major cities like Jakarta, Surabaya, and Bali, the need for ISO tank containers continues to rise.
Factors Driving Growth
Several factors contribute to the rapid expansion of the ISO tank container market:
- Increased Trade Activities: With a global increase in trade activities, especially in the ASEAN region, the demand for ISO tank containers is on the rise.
- Focus on Safety: Industries are prioritizing safe transportation of hazardous and non-hazardous liquids, making ISO tank containers a preferred choice.
- Cost-Efficiency: The use of ISO tank containers reduces shipping costs by allowing bulk transportation and minimizing the risk of contamination.
- Technological Advancements: Innovations in container design and materials enhance durability and accessibility, making ISO tanks more appealing to exporters.

Challenges and Considerations
Despite the positive outlook, the ISO tank container market faces challenges that need addressing. These include:
- Regulatory Compliance: Navigating the complex landscape of international shipping regulations can be daunting for companies.
- Supply Chain Disruptions: External factors, such as global pandemics and geopolitical tensions, can impact supply chains.
- Market Competition: The increasing number of players in the market raises concerns about pricing and service quality.
